The legal procedure for mesothelioma lawsuits is different from state to state. However, the majority of lawsuits be settled prior to reaching the trial stage. Settlements are reached when both parties reach an agreement on a price to compensate the victim for their losses. Compensation includes both economic damages and non-economic damages. Economic damages can include medical expenses, lost income, and other expenses. Non-economic damages include emotional distress, pain and mental suffering.

Mesothelioma compensation is available to victims through three sources - asbestos trust funds, lawsuits and settlements. Trust funds for asbestos are set up by bankrupt asbestos companies to ensure their victims and their families receive compensation for illnesses caused by asbestos. Victims can be compensated for mesothelioma within 90 days if their claim is successful. The amount of compensation will be contingent on a variety of factors, including the method of review and which mesothelioma trust fund to file with. The expedited review offers a fast payment for claims that meet pre-set requirements as well as individual reviews that provide an in-depth look into the case.

The duration of a mesothelioma case can vary depending on the amount of compensation demanded. In many cases, the parties in a mesothelioma lawsuit will agree to settle in order to avoid costly litigation and the chance of losing the case completely. If the defendants don't want to settle their claim, it could take more than a year before a final decision is reached.

In the case of a trial verdict the jury will decide which defendants are liable and award compensation to the victim or their family. The compensation is usually given in monthly installments rather than one lump sum payment.
